Carlino's 21 not quite enough for Marquette at St. John's

Matt Carlino scored 21 points, but Marquette couldn't hold the momentum for a full 40 minutes in a 60-57 loss at St. John's Wednesday night.

The Golden Eagles took a lead late in the second half on a Sandy Cohen III layup with less than five minutes to play. But back to back buckets from Sir'Dominic Pointer gave St. John's the lead for good in the game's final minutes.

Derrick Wilson put up one of the season's more unusual stat lines for MU - in 31 minutes, Wilson attempted one shot - a three pointer - and missed. Yet Wilson grabbed seven rebounds and dished out six assists for Marquette (10-8, 2-4 Big East).
